Problems solved by technology

[0003] Since the position of the hidden handle needs to be changed, and it involves an electric and mechanical two-way structure, compared with the traditional fixed handle, there are more parts and the structure is much more complicated.
In the actual use process, there are still many defects in the existing hidden handles, for example: 1. The electric structure is complex, there are many parts, the cost is high, and the failure rate is high in actual use, resulting in a decrease in the overall reliability of the handle; 2. When the current mechanical handle is opened, one hand is required to press the handle, and the other hand is used to open the door. When opening, both hands are required to operate at the same time, which brings inconvenience to the operation, otherwise it is easy to pinch the handle with one-handed operation; 3. At present, the opening angle of the mechanical handle is related to most parts in the entire handle structure. Therefore, when the angle needs to be adjusted in a mature product, it is often necessary to redesign all related parts to match each other, which is very troublesome and expensive. High; 4. At present, the mechanical handle has no anti-lock function; 5. At present, the mechanical handle is not reset in place after being reset, and there is a second opening phenomenon; 6. When the electric structure is opened, it is necessary to start the circuit in the car in advance, and there is a motor during operation. noise

Abstract

The invention discloses a self-locking mechanical backswing handle. The self-locking mechanical backswing handle comprises a handle main body, a handle base, an unlocking mechanism and a driving mechanism, wherein the handle main body at least has an initial position form, a pre-unfolding position form of extending out of an automobile door and a complete opening position form in which the automobile door is opened; the handle base is installed in the automobile door; and the handle main body is installed in the handle base. The self-locking mechanical backswing handle is characterized in thatthe handle main body further has a driving position form between the initial position form and the pre-unfolding position form, and a self-locking position form in which the automobile door is closedand locked; the unlocking mechanism is connected with an automobile door lock; the driving mechanism is arranged between the handle main body and the handle base and is in transmission connection with the handle main body; and the driving mechanism has an initial locking state, a release driving state and an unlocking driving state. According to the self-locking mechanical backswing handle, a pure mechanical hidden swing-out structure is adopted, so that the number of parts is small, the structure is reasonable and simple, cost is low, stability is high in the actual use process, the failurerate is greatly reduced, and the whole handle is more stable and reliable.

Description

technical field [0001] The invention relates to the technical field of handles, in particular to a self-locking mechanical swing back handle applied to the outer handle of an automobile door. Background technique [0002] The car door handles of most automobiles are all exposed convex designs at present, and there are many defects. When designing the handle, on the one hand, it is necessary to consider that the shape of the car door handle needs to match the side of the car body to ensure a good appearance, so there will be many limitations; It is easy to get contaminated, and the driver can easily get his hands dirty when opening the door. Moreover, the outside handle of the door is exposed and convex, which not only damages the appearance of the side of the vehicle, but also creates a certain amount of wind resistance, which increases the driving resistance of the car and increases the wind noise.
